Traffic Notice: Partial Intersection Closure of Carlaw Avenue and Lakeshore Boulevard East starting Friday, October 3 at 9 PM until Tuesday, October 7 at 5AM 


The intersection of Carlaw Avenue and Lake Shore Boulevard East will be partially closed starting the evening of October 3 to allow work along the median. Northbound/southbound traffic on Carlaw will be restricted, and eastbound Lake Shore Boulevard traffic will be reduced to one lane approaching the intersection. Southbound traffic on Carlaw will also be reduced to one lane, with right turns on a green light permitted for local traffic only. On Lake Shore Boulevard going westbound, right turns at Carlaw will be permitted, while left turns will be restricted. The north/south pedestrian crossing on the east side of the intersection will remain open. This closure is the last stage of construction for this intersection.

What to expect starting Friday, October 3: 

• North/south traffic will be restricted along Carlaw Avenue. East/west traffic along Lake Shore Boulevard East will be maintained. 
• All lane closures will be marked with traffic barrels or fencing. 
• Access to the Esso station is available on the south side of Lake Shore Boulevard East 2 
• Paid-duty officers will be at on site during the closure to keep traffic flowing as smoothly as possible.
